LampPro Tip 1/3

Understanding Context

'Scoreline' is primarily used in sports, be mindful of the audience when using it.

In a football match, the scoreline may indicate a dominant performance.
LampPro Tip 2/3

Metaphorical Use

You can use 'scoreline' in broader competition contexts beyond sports.

In the business world, the scoreline of a project could refer to success metrics.
LampPro Tip 3/3

Formality

In formal writing, specify the sport context when mentioning 'scoreline' for clarity.

Always define the scoreline clearly in sports reports.
